I am recruiting for an IT Support Engineer to work full time on site in Norwich.
The role falls inside IR35 so you will need to work through an umbrella company for the duration of the contract.
You will be covering Norfolk and Suffolk Customer Bases so will need to be able to drive and have access to your own transport.
You will provide second line customer focused support, solving technical incidents and problems remotely, or if necessary, in person; to service and improve software and computer hardware.
You will have working knowledge of Active Directory, users, computers and security groups and also a working knowledge of Microsoft Operating Systems; Windows 11.
Experience of Sophos console, asset management solutions and Citrix is also essential.
You must also have a working knowledge of Microsoft Office 365.
